      As a Patrol Officer you will provide armed security for all BIW facilities.

      • Follow all company and department operating procedures.
      • Write incident reports and maintain logs.
      • Must be able to work fixed posts, waterborne assignments and conduct walking checks of facilities.

      This position requires you to be able to obtain a government security clearance. You must be a US Citizen for consideration and you must be able to obtain an interim security clearance within the first 45 days of hire.       Bath Iron Works is a major United States shipyard located on the Kennebec River in Bath, Maine, founded in 1884 as Bath Iron Works, Limited.
